Output 328985d95b7b510476c132a3e3e82577d2f393802d18586212dca120dd2ce7d6:16

value
14087936
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0b58c37e0d0e4454604296c790dfc4a7cb68fee4 OP_EQUAL
address
32j1h4ReDH11hD7hMjpEx9323GK9PsL3VG
transaction
328985d95b7b510476c132a3e3e82577d2f393802d18586212dca120dd2ce7d6
confirmations
414536
spent
true